What is Magnesium Glycinate?

To understand what is benefits of magnesium glycinate, we first have to look at its chemistry. Magnesium glycinate is what scientists call a "chelated" mineral. In this form, elemental magnesium is chemically bonded to two molecules of glycine, a non-essential amino acid. This pairing is not just a random combination; it is a strategic design that changes how the mineral behaves inside your digestive tract.

Glycine itself is a fascinating amino acid. It is often used by the body to support the nervous system and help maintain a sense of calm. When magnesium is "wrapped" in glycine, it becomes much more stable. Unlike other forms that may break apart too early in the digestive process, magnesium glycinate travels through the stomach more effectively. Because it is recognized as an amino acid by the body, it can use different transport pathways in the small intestine, leading to superior absorption.

The Bioavailability Differentiator

One of the most frequent questions we encounter is why someone should choose glycinate over a more common, often cheaper form like magnesium oxide. The answer lies in the "Trust Pillar" of absorption.

Magnesium oxide has a very high percentage of elemental magnesium by weight, which looks great on a nutrition facts panel. However, research suggests that its absorption rate can be as low as 4%. Most of it simply stays in the gut, where it attracts water and often leads to a laxative effect. For those looking to support their internal mineral stores rather than just move their bowels, oxide is rarely the best choice.

Magnesium glycinate, on the other hand, is designed with the body’s uptake mechanisms in mind. Because the magnesium is protected by the glycine molecules, it is less likely to react with other phytates or compounds in your food that might block absorption. Bone Health and Beyond

While we often think of calcium as the primary driver of bone health, magnesium is the unsung hero that makes it all work. About 60% of the magnesium in your body is stored in your bones. It contributes to the structural development of bone and is necessary for the transport of calcium and potassium ions across cell membranes.

Furthermore, magnesium is required to "activate" Vitamin D. Without sufficient magnesium, your body cannot properly utilize the Vitamin D you get from the sun or supplements. The Problem with Modern Soil

You might wonder, "Can't I just get enough magnesium from my diet?" In an ideal world, the answer would be yes. However, modern agricultural practices have significantly changed the nutrient profile of our food.

Due to soil depletion, the spinach and almonds we eat today often contain significantly less magnesium than they did 50 years ago. Pesticides and synthetic fertilizers can interfere with a plant’s ability to take up minerals from the earth. Additionally, the standard modern diet—often high in processed foods, refined sugars, and caffeine—can actually increase the amount of magnesium your body excretes.

Safety and Considerations

Magnesium glycinate is widely considered one of the safest and best-tolerated forms of magnesium. Because the kidneys are remarkably efficient at filtering out excess magnesium in healthy individuals, the risk of "taking too much" is low for most people.

However, there are a few things to keep in mind:

  • Kidney Health: If you have any history of kidney concerns, you must consult a healthcare professional before starting a magnesium supplement, as the kidneys are responsible for regulating mineral levels.
  • Medication Interactions: Magnesium can interact with certain antibiotics and blood pressure medications. Always follow the rule of "consulting your doctor" if you are under medical supervision or taking prescription drugs.
  • Pregnancy and Breastfeeding: Mineral needs change significantly during these times. While magnesium is often recommended, it is always best to get personalized guidance from your healthcare provider.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. How is magnesium glycinate different from magnesium citrate?

Magnesium glycinate is magnesium bound to the amino acid glycine, making it highly bioavailable and very gentle on the digestive system. It is primarily used for relaxation, sleep, and muscle support. Magnesium citrate is magnesium bound to citric acid; while it is also well-absorbed, it has a natural laxative effect and is often used to support regular bowel movements. If you have a sensitive stomach, glycinate is usually the preferred choice.

2. Can I take magnesium glycinate every day?

Yes, many people find that taking magnesium glycinate daily helps them maintain consistent mineral levels and supports ongoing balance in their sleep and stress response. However, it is always important to follow the serving size on the label and consult with a healthcare professional to determine the right amount for your specific needs, especially if you have kidney issues or are taking other medications.

3. Does magnesium glycinate make you feel drowsy during the day?

While magnesium glycinate supports relaxation and the nervous system, it is not a sedative. Most people find that taking it during the day helps them feel more "composed" and resilient to stress without feeling tired. However, because it can support restful sleep, many people choose to take their largest serving in the evening to take advantage of its calming properties before bed.
